0. add slowlog bf. 0. LPUSHX. 0 Time complexity: O(1) Get the size of an auto-complete suggestion dictionary. 0. Time complexity: O (1) for every call. SUGADD Adds a suggestion string to an auto-complete suggestion dictionary Read more FT. SUGADD autocomplete "hello world" 100 OK 127. include: specifies an inclusion custom dictionary. SUGDEL Deletes a string from a suggestion index Read more FT. The index is maintained by each instance outside of the database keyspace, so only updates to the hashes in the databases are synchronized. TDIGEST. 127. SCARD key Available since: 1. 1:6379> TS. I've encountered situations where this causes unexpected collisions. N is. . _LIST Returns a list of all existing indexes Read more FT. SUGADD Adds a suggestion string to an auto-complete. Switch to a different protocol, optionally authenticating and setting the connection's name, or. 0. Each suggestion has a score and string. ExamplesHELLO [protover [AUTH username password] [SETNAME clientname]] Available since: 6. 0. 0. ]] [arg [arg. sock[1]> FT. O (N) where N is the number of client connections. SUGDEL Deletes a string from a suggestion index Read more FT. SUGGET. FT. Object[] occured on line client. 0. Time complexity: O (1) when path is evaluated to a single value, O (N) when path is evaluated to multiple values, where N is the size of the key. SUGADD command in RediSearch, the file data like name, created, timestamp, mimetype, filetype, size, summary and image file path are added using the JSON. You switched accounts on another tab or window. FT. Welcome to Fogg N Suds. 04 LTS (focal) Following packages were installed using apt-get redis-redisearch version: 1. ALIASADD FT. Create a consumer named <consumername> in the consumer group <groupname> of the stream that's stored at <key>. FT. 0. Examples. md at master · RediSearch/RediSearch Syntax. Return the number of keys in the currently-selected database. Toggle navigation. is suggestion dictionary key. Time complexity: O (N) where N is the number of clients subscribed to the receiving shard channel. Examplesft for feet. Note that it is valid to call this command without channels, in this case it will just return an empty list. FT. LINSERT. 8. Finding all the documents that have a specific term is O(1), however, a scan on all those documents is needed to load the documents data. Hello. Range (which takes args and returns List) to work. SUG* is not meant for this purposes. The commands are: FT. You can find out more about the available clients1 Answer. SUGADD autocomplete “John Smith” 1. 0. When Redis is configured to use an ACL file (with the aclfile configuration option), this command will save the currently defined ACLs from the server memory to the ACL file. If you just want to check that a given item was added to a cuckoo filter, use CF. CF. Return. JSON. 2. CREATE <index_name> <field> [<score>|NUMERIC]. AGGREGATE Run a search query on an index and perform aggregate transformations on the results. Projects 4. 1:6379> TS. autocomplete): FT. SUGGET autocomplete "he" 1) "hello world" Frequently Asked Questions What is the Redis module? Hi I'm trying to use RediSearch to employ an autocomplete system on my searches. RESP key [path] Available in: Redis Stack / JSON 1. 0. FT. 0 Time complexity: O(1) ACL categories: @admin, @fast, @dangerous,. LIST georadiusbymember_ro cf. Note that the module's name is reported by the MODULE LIST command, and may differ from the dynamic library's filename. SUGADD adds a suggestion string to an auto-complete suggestion dictionary. When used inside a MULTI / EXEC block, this command behaves exactly like ZMPOP . 7, last published: 4 months ago. RediSearch supports other interesting features such as indexing numeric values (prices, dates,. 0. RPUSHX. SCANDUMP key iterator. HMSET (deprecated) As of Redis version 4. SYNUPDATE can be used to create or update a synonym group with. RESP2/RESP3. Multiple items can be added at once. - RediSearch/Quick_Start. 0. FT. O (N) where N is the number of elements to traverse before seeing the value pivot. Each element is an Array reply of information about a single chunk in a name ( Simple string reply )-value pairs: - startTimestamp - Integer reply - First timestamp present in the chunk. 0 Time complexity: O(1) for each message ID processed. 0. is end timestamp for the range deletion. With LATEST, TS. FT. SEARCH to search across all the fields in the document but i am curious to know/understand why FT. 2. Adds a suggestion string to an auto-complete suggestion dictionary is key name for the time series. I would propose prefixing the key internally (similar to how the. Contribute to vruizext/redisearch-rb development by creating an account on GitHub. 0. 0 Time complexity: O(1) ACL categories: @write, @hash, @fast,. It is meant to be used for developing and testing Redis. Syntax. You signed in with another tab or window. In this case, a message for every unsubscribed. SEARCH complexity is O (n) for single word queries. You can achieve similar results without such protection using TS. 1:6379> FT. FT. FT. The second argument is the number of input key name arguments, followed by all the keys accessed by the function. Contribute to RediSearch/redisearch-py development by creating an account on GitHub. N is. SUGGET autocomplete “he” 1) “hello world” See the FT. Add suggestion terms to the AutoCompleter engine. The CLIENT REPLY command controls whether the server will reply the client's commands. Client (s) can subscribe to a node covering a slot (primary/replica) to. Time complexity: O (log (N)+M) with N being the number of elements in the sorted set and M the number of elements being returned. ExamplesPatterns. Syntax. ACL categories: @slow,. By using a negative increment value, the result is that the value stored at the key is decremented (by the obvious properties of addition). Redis modules. GitHub Gist: instantly share code, notes, and snippets. SUGGET Gets completion suggestions for a prefix Read more FT. This command resets the slow log, clearing all entries in it. 0. AGGREGATE Run a search query on an index and perform aggregate transformations on the results.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. . We use the FT. ] Available in: Redis Stack / JSON 2. n is the number of the results in the result set. SUGADD the user’s search query to the suggestion with an INCR argument. SUGADD FT. What ever your. SUGADD userslex %b 1", "u010Cajiu0107", sizeof("u01. Because of this semantic MSETNX can be used in order to set different keys representing different fields of a unique logic object in a way that ensures that either all the fields or none at all are set. CREATE command, which has the syntax: FT. This is very useful when using Redis to store. 0. . If end is larger than the end of the list, Redis will treat it like the last element of the list. This is the default mode in which the server returns a reply to every command. JSON. key (str) – string (str) – Return type. The symmetric command used to alter the configuration at run time is CONFIG SET. MRANGE also reports the compacted value of the latest possibly partial bucket, given that this bucket's start time falls within [fromTimestamp, toTimestamp]. In version 2. Where N is the number of configured users. If I will understand the usage pattern it might help me to reproduce the issue. HSCAN iterates fields of Hash types and their associated values. Append the json values into the array at path after the last element in it. create. SUGGET to test auto-complete suggestions: 127. max evalsha cf. Returns the number of fields contained in the hash stored at key. HMSET key field value [field value. is key name for an existing t-digest sketch. AGGREGATE libraries-idx "@location: [-73. FT. 0,false); StackTrace is here, at StackExchange. INCRBYFLOAT. Executes all previously queued commands in a transaction and restores the connection state to normal. sugadd, a key get created with the exact name of the index. The TYPE type subcommand filters the list. FT. Examples Retrieve configuration options When creating suggestions using ft. WAITAOF. FT. 0) 時間計算量: O (1) オートコンプリート候補辞書に候補文字列を追加します。. You can use the optional command-name argument to specify the names of one or more commands. 6, this command is regarded as deprecated. n is the number of the results in the result set. By default, the command pops a. The auto-complete suggestion dictionary is disconnected from the index definitions and leaves creating and updating suggestions dictionaries to the user. 0. is start timestamp for the range deletion. 0. 0 Time complexity: Depends on subcommand. SUGDEL Deletes a string from a suggestion index Read more FT. JSON. ] Available in: Redis Stack / JSON 1. The library is under active development by RedisLabs and other contributors. FT. An element is. The first argument is the name of a loaded function. SUGDEL Deletes a string from a suggestion index Read more FT. FT. 959 * <ft> RediSearch version 1. Add a sample to the time series, setting the. Syntax. Suppose a sensor ticks whenever a car is passed on a road, and you want to count occurrences. The LOLWUT command displays the Redis version: however as a side effect of doing so, it also creates a piece of generative computer art that is different with each version of Redis. CLIENT PAUSE is a connections control command able to suspend all the Redis clients for the specified amount of time (in milliseconds). ExamplesFT. If an item enters the Top-K list, the item which is expelled is returned. Initiates a replication stream from the master. The Recipe; Prolog; Preparing the ingredients; Search Server; The Client; One of the common use cases that I have encountered lately is to have search capabilities. 4. Adds an item to a cuckoo filter if the item does not exist. SUGADD Adds a suggestion string to an auto-complete suggestion dictionary Read more FT. next_command() method returns one command from monitor listen() method yields commands from monitor. 0. ACL categories: @slow,. First of all, you need to save the post time of each item. SUGLEN', 'ac'). TDIGEST. SUGADD Adds a suggestion string to an auto-complete suggestion dictionary Read more FT. ZREMRANGEBYSCORE key min max. Return. SUGDEL - Deletes a suggestion string from an auto-complete dictionary. 0 Time complexity: Depends on subcommand. 3 Time complexity: O(1) ACL categories: @keyspace, @read, @slow,. First, we have to Setup the connection and load the required. SUGDEL. {"payload":{"allShortcutsEnabled":false,"fileTree":{"docs":{"items":[{"name":"libs","path":"docs/libs","contentType":"directory"},{"name":"Presentation. Append new. I use the programming language Rust as my server and currently have the following code which sends a command to the database: pub fn ft_sugadd(index: String. Examples. Contributor. Increments the score of member in the sorted set stored at key by increment . SUGGET - Get a list of suggestions for a string. This time series will contain one compacted sample per 24 hours: the difference between the minimum and the maximum temperature measured between 06:00 and 06:00 next day. 0 Time complexity: O(N) where N is the number of members being requested. To see the list of available commands you can call PUBSUB HELP. 0. SUGADD Adds a suggestion string to an auto-complete suggestion dictionary Read more FT. Keys with an expire. is suggestion dictionary key. SUGGET returns an array reply, which is a list of the top suggestions matching the prefix, optionally with score after each entry. Examples Search On Steroids 9 minute read On this page. If the key does not exist, it is set to 0 before performing the operation. SUGADD adds a suggestion string to an auto-complete suggestion dictionary. Return.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. Return value has an array with two elements: Results - The normal reply. Lunch/Dinner: 11:00am – 10:00pm. . 0 Time complexity: O(1) Delete a string from a suggestion index. Count sensor captures. When a time series is not a compaction, LATEST is ignored. LATEST (since RedisTimeSeries v1. It is like the original BITFIELD but only accepts GET subcommand and can safely be used in read-only replicas. TDIGEST. HSETNX key field value Available since: 2. Returns if field is an existing field in the hash stored at key. 0. 0 Time complexity: Depends on how much memory is allocated, could be slow ACL categories: @slow,. ]] [AGGREGATE <SUM | MIN | MAX>] [WITHSCORES] O (N)+O (M*log (M)) with N being the sum of the sizes of the input sorted sets, and M being the number of elements in the resulting sorted set. FT. FT. FT. FT. SUGGET autocomplete "he" 1) "hello world" Frequently Asked Questions What is the Redis module? Redis modules are the dynamic libraries that can be loaded into Redis using the MODULE LOAD command or during startup. 0. SUGADD / FT. 0. Adds a suggestion string to an auto-complete suggestion dictionaryFT. ACL categories: @admin, @slow, @dangerous, @connection. Returns 1 if the string was found and deleted, 0 otherwise. Usage in Redis Cluster. ACL categories: @slow,. Object[] occured on line client. 0 Time complexity: O(1) Returns, for each input value (floating-point), the estimated reverse rank of the value (the number of observations in the sketch that are larger than the value + half the number of observations that are equal to the value). Load a script into the scripts cache, without executing it. 8. CREATE key [COMPRESSION compression] Available in: Redis Stack / Bloom 2. _LIST Returns a list of all existing indexes Read more FT. byrank hexists geopos FT. SEARCH and FT. 0. execute_command ('ft. _LIST Returns a list of all existing indexes Read more FT. 127. The CONFIG HELP command returns a helpful text describing the different subcommands. Normally Redis keys are created without an associated time to live. SCANDUMP. Syntax. SUGADD] Within seconds of uploading the dataset, all keys are indexed and suggestion dictionaries are populated and notifies the user in the frontend. _LIST Returns a list of all existing indexes Read more FT. Time complexity: O (1) Returns, for each input value (floating-point), the estimated reverse rank of the value (the number of observations in the sketch that are larger than the value + half the number of observations that are equal to the value). INFO key Available in: Redis Stack / Bloom 2. If field does not exist the value is set to 0 before the operation is performed. FT. ConnectionMulti. ZINCRBY. expect ('ft. 0. The Trie in the RDB tells me that you are also using the suggestion api (SUGADD, SUGGET,. Not all the configuration parameters are supported in Redis 2. equal (sz) sz += 1 for _ in r. It is possible to use MOVE as a. commands. Hi I'm trying to use RediSearch to employ an autocomplete system on my searches. Examples. JSON. FT. SUGADD Adds a suggestion string to an auto-complete suggestion dictionary Read more FT. 0 Time complexity: O(1) ACL categories: @slow,. FT. 0. WATCH key [key. SUGDEL returns an integer reply, 1 if the string was found and deleted, 0 otherwise. SUGADD Adds a suggestion string to an auto-complete suggestion dictionary Read more FT. SUGADD は、提案辞書の現在のサイズを表す整数の応答を返します。 Examples オートコンプリート候補辞書に候補文字列. Contribute to tolitius/obiwan development by creating an account on GitHub. ] 利用可能: Redis Stack ( Search 1. 12 Time complexity: O(N) where N is the number of entries in the slowlog ACL categories: @admin, @slow, @dangerous,. REVRANGE also reports the compacted value of the latest, possibly partial, bucket, given that this bucket's start time falls within [fromTimestamp, toTimestamp]. 0. Parameters:Create an Active-Active database with RediSearch 2. {num} is the number of stopwords, followed by a list of stopword arguments exactly the length of {num}. FT. 0. SUGGET. FT. For example, you can set a key-value pair for each item, with key as item name, and value as post time. RediSearch supports other interesting features such as indexing numeric values (prices, dates,. Removes all elements in the sorted set stored at key with a score between min and max (inclusive). ExamplesFT. Syntax. SLOWLOG RESET Available since: 2. 127. They can change user using AUTH. g. Uses 0 as initial value if the key doesn't exist. HEXISTS key field Available since: 2. 0. FT. SUGDEL Deletes a string from a suggestion index Read more FT. FT. ] O (N) where N is the number of shard channels to subscribe to. O (K) + O (M*log (N)) where K is the number of provided keys, N being the number of elements in the sorted set, and M being the number of elements popped. An example use case is like we have set of address for a common place and when user starts typing the suburb name we want to list all the address in that suburb for the. AGGREGATE Run a search query on an index and perform aggregate transformations on the results. 0. Time complexity: O (log (N)+M) with N being the number of elements in the sorted set and M the number of elements removed by the operation. NUMINCRBY doc $. Returns the number of unique patterns that are subscribed to by clients (that are performed using the PSUBSCRIBE command). The file is then stored on the S3 bucket as an object with the key as the filename. FT. AGGREGATE Run a search query on an index and perform aggregate transformations on the results.